Red Salmon Complex Update – Red Flag Warning, Heavy Smoke Impacts

The Red Salmon Complex — comprising the Red and Salmon fires burning on the Klamath, Six Rivers and Shasta-Trinity National Forests within Humboldt, Siskiyou and Trinity counties — currently stands at 47,934 acres with 20 percent containment, according to this morning’s update. Fire crews battling the fires face challenges presented by winds expected to increase today […]

Red Salmon Fire Now Over 15,000 Acres

The Red Salmon Complex is now at 15,129 acres with 35 percent containment, according to this morning’s update. The update also states that thunderstorm potential continues to wane and a gradual cooling trend will start today with humidity near normal levels. Smoke will flow down into canyons and valleys again this evening.
